Handover: rotatekit, our internal secrets-rotation utility. Before you review the branch, context: the scheduler now staggers rotations across the Hollowmere and Tarn clusters to avoid thundering-herd renewals, and the dry-run flag actually dry-runs now (it didn't before — see commit notes). Test fixtures use a throwaway vault seeded in CI, so nothing touches prod material. To reproduce the integration suite locally you must unseal the fixture vault yourself. The recovery passphrase for that fixture vault is:

vault phrase of kawep-tahog = ulaix-briath

### Step 4: Migrate the reminder job

The Oakbrace clinic reminder job moves from cron to the Tilden scheduler in this step. Stop the old cron entry first — running both will double-text patients. Import the job definition, confirm the dry-run flag is set, and replay yesterday's batch to verify output matches. Only then disable dry-run. Do not change the send window without sign-off from the scheduling team. Set the job's configuration to the following values.

config for tagep-yajef:
ulawyn:
  log_level: error
  metrics_host: metrics.ulawyn.lumiclabs.internal
  pin: 0564
  pool_size: 32

Hey Tamsin,

Welcome aboard! Quick handover on the Quillbird date-format work: we're switching all locales to the new formatter in release 4.2, and the Norvane team already signed off on the string changes. Builds go out Thursday. You'll need to sign the localization bundle yourself before upload, so I'm passing along the deploy key you should use below.

rollout seal: bky4_DFM9

Logistics Provider Change — Managers Only (Board Briefing)

Effective next quarter, Brindale Freight replaces Covatch Haulage as primary logistics provider for all Northvale routes. Drivers: a 9% cost reduction, improved cold-chain coverage, and Covatch's repeated missed-SLA penalties. Transition runs over six weeks with dual-running in weeks three and four. Contract term is three years with annual review. The switch supports the broader direction set out in the confidential note below.

board note of kageg-bahof: The renewal with Holwynax Holdings closes at $2 million a year, 5 percent below the last contract. Project Ulaath slips by two quarters because of the supplier delay.